在互联网浏览的过程中,我们偶尔会遇到“HTTP 403 Forbidden”的错误提示,这通常意味着服务器理解客户端的请求但拒绝执行,本文将深入探讨HTTP 403错误的原因、其对用户体验的影响以及有效的解决策略。
一、HTTP 403错误概述
HTTP状态码403是一个标准的响应代码,当Web服务器由于权限不足而无法提供所请求的资源时返回此代码,这与401 Unauthorized不同,后者表示用户未被授权访问资源,需要通过身份验证;而403则直接表明即使进行了身份验证,用户也没有权限查看该资源。
二、常见原因分析
1、权限设置不当:文件或目录的权限配置不正确,导致即使用户已登录也无法访问特定内容。
2、IP地址限制:某些网站会基于用户的IP地址来限制访问,如果你的IP不在允许列表中,就会收到403错误。
3、Referer头部检查:一些站点要求请求必须来自特定的网页(即正确的Referer),否则会拒绝服务。
4、安全插件或软件:如Wordpress等平台上的安全插件可能会错误地将合法用户标记为潜在的威胁并阻止其访问。
5、服务器配置问题:Apache、Nginx等Web服务器软件的配置错误也可能导致不必要的403错误。
三、对用户体验的影响
对于最终用户而言,频繁遭遇403错误不仅令人沮丧,还可能损害他们对品牌的信任感,特别是当这种情况发生在购物车页面或者结账过程中时,直接关系到转化率和收入损失,过多的403错误也可能被搜索引擎视为网站不稳定的表现之一,进而影响到SEO排名。
四、解决策略建议
检查文件权限:确保目标文件/目录具有适当的读写执行权限,Linux系统中可以使用chmod
命令调整权限;Windows环境下则需要右键属性里修改安全选项卡下的设置。
审查防火墙规则:如果使用了硬件防火墙或是云服务提供商提供的安全防护服务,请仔细检查相关规则是否过于严格。
更新白名单:如果是有意为之的IP地址过滤机制造成的403,那么就需要及时更新允许列表以包含所有必要的源IP。
调整Referer政策:对于依赖Referer头信息的应用来说,应该谨慎处理这部分逻辑,避免因小失大。
优化服务器配置:定期审查并优化你的Web服务器配置文件,删除任何不必要的限制条款,同时也要注意保持软件版本最新,以利用最新的安全特性和性能改进。
联系管理员:如果你认为这是一个误会或者是系统故障引起的问题,最好的做法是直接向网站管理员报告情况寻求帮助。
虽然HTTP 403错误看似简单却背后隐藏着复杂的技术细节,作为开发者或者运维人员,了解这些基础知识能够帮助我们更快地定位问题所在,并采取相应措施加以解决,从而提升整体服务水平和用户满意度,而对于普通网民来说,遇到此类情况时也不必过分紧张,按照上述指导尝试几种方法往往就能解决问题。
随着互联网的普及和信息技术的飞速发展台湾vps云服务器邮件,电子邮件已经成为企业和个人日常沟通的重要工具。然而,传统的邮件服务在安全性、稳定性和可扩展性方面存在一定的局限性。为台湾vps云服务器邮件了满足用户对高效、安全、稳定的邮件服务的需求,台湾VPS云服务器邮件服务应运而生。本文将对台湾VPS云服务器邮件服务进行详细介绍,分析其优势和应用案例,并为用户提供如何选择合适的台湾VPS云服务器邮件服务的参考建议。
工作时间:8:00-18:00
电子邮件
1968656499@qq.com
扫码二维码
获取最新动态